Conflict in Sudan’s Darfur region devastating forests too
Aside from killing hundreds of thousands of people and displacing millions more, the ongoing conflict in Sudan’s Darfur region is also taking a toll on the environment. Displaced people have cut down huge swaths of forest to make mud bricks in wood-fired kilns and to use as cooking fuel. Farmers expelled from their land have […]

Over 1,000 gallons of oil spilled off California coast
Over 1,100 gallons of oil spilled off the coast of Santa Barbara, Calif., Sunday when a pump line on an offshore oil rig sprung a leak, causing a mile-and-a-half-long oil slick that state regulators said was mostly cleaned up by Monday morning. In 1969, the same rig was the site of a massive, 200,000 gallon […]
